Math Placement & ALEKS PPL

Incoming students can avoid taking unnecessary math courses by demonstrating prerequisite knowledge with previous coursework, or by taking the ALEKS PPL assessment.

How can high school courses be used to place me in higher math courses?

Students who have met either of the conditions below are qualified to register for any of the following courses: MATH 105, MATH 107, MATH 109 or STAT 109. 

A grade of B- or better in both semesters of a high school course titled “Precalculus”

or

A grade of C or better in both semesters of a high school course titled “Calculus, AP Calculus, or IB Math (Year 2).”  

*** If there is a delay in processing your high school transcripts you may need to contact the Mathematics Department, math@humboldt.edu.

How can college courses be used to place me in higher math courses?

College Prerequisite courses are listed in the Course Catalog (https://catalog.humboldt.edu/). Courses taken at Cal Poly Humboldt will automatically allow you to register, but if you took an equivalent course at another college you may need to contact the Mathematics Department, math@humboldt.edu.

What is the ALEKS PPL assessment?

ALEKS PPL determines whether you've met the prerequisites for certain math courses. This optional online program maps your strengths and weaknesses through an assessment of up to 30 questions, taking about 60–90 minutes to complete. 

The assessment includes:

  • Practice assessments: Up to four attempts you can complete online at your convenience
  • Prep and Learning Module: An individualized, self-paced online review to improve your skills between attempts
  • Final proctored assessment: Completed on campus during a scheduled session the week before classes; required to change your placement

Can I take ALEKS PPL? 

You must be an incoming student who has never taken math classes at Humboldt.

How do I use ALEKS PPL to change my placement?

  1. Request access: Contact the Mathematics Department at math@humboldt.edu to register.
  2. Practice at home: Complete up to four practice assessments online at your convenience.
  3. Final assessment on campus: To change your placement, you must complete the final proctored assessment during a scheduled session the week before classes. Dates are announced in advance.

Signup instructions for the proctored final assessment are included with your ALEKS registration information.

What courses will an ALEKS PPL score qualify me for?

Course #Course NameALEKS Score Range
MATH 101College AlgebraOver 45 (Recommended: 45-55)
MATH 101TTrigonometryOver 65 (Recommended: 66-77)
MATH 102Algebra & Elementary FunctionsOver 45 (Recommended: 56-77)
MATH 103Mathematics as a Liberal ArtOver 45
MATH 104Finite MathOver 45
MATH 105Calculus for the Biological Sci.78-100
MATH 107Intro to Linear Algebra78-100
MATH 108Critical Thinking in MathOver 45
MATH 109Calculus I78-100
STAT 108Elementary StatisticsOver 45
STAT 109Introductory BiostatisticsOver 65
